Question to the Department of Health and Social Care:
To ask the Secretary of State for Health, how many GP practices have (a) opened and (b) closed in (i) Merseyside and (ii) Knowsley in each of the last five years.
The data requested is shown in the following table.
These figures include practice mergers and takeovers and do not provide an accurate representation of activity or service provision for patients. For example, the merger of three practices may show as three practices closing and one opening, or alternatively, as three practices closing and none opening (where two practices merge into another already existing practice).
2014 to 30 September | 2013 | 2012 | 2011 | 2010 | 2009 | |
Closed: Mersey Area Team (excluding Wirral) | 1 | 3 | 1 | 2 | 2 | 2 |
Opened: Mersey Area Team (excluding Wirral) |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 1 | 12 |
Closed: Cheshire, Warrington and Wirral Area Team | 2 | 4 | 3 | 3 | 2 | 1 |
Opened: Cheshire, Warrington and Wirral Area Team | 1 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 1 | 4 |
Closed: NHS Knowsley Clinial Commissioning Group |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Opened: NHS Knowsley Clinical Commissioning Group |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 4 |
Source: Health and Social Care Information Centre
